3 Season Rooms

A 3 season room in Des Moines works great for spring, summer, and fall. Screened panels keep bugs out while you enjoy fresh air. Many homeowners use them for dining, reading, or hosting small gatherings.

We build with durable screening materials that handle Iowa wind and weather. Proper ventilation keeps the space comfortable even on warmer days.

4 Season Rooms

A 4 season room gives you usable space all year long in Des Moines. Insulated walls, tempered glass, and heating keep it cozy even in winter.

Perfect for offices, playrooms, or quiet retreats. We handle ventilation, electrical, and heating integration so you can relax year-round.

Covered Porches & Decks

A covered porch or deck extension adds outdoor living without the full-room investment. Great for Des Moines families who want shade and weather protection.

We build with proper grading and drainage to handle Iowa rain. Choose from open beam designs, solid roofs, or partial coverings to match your home.

Built for Des Moines Weather

Iowa's freeze-thaw cycles and heavy moisture demand proper foundation, drainage, and ventilation. We design for local conditions so your room lasts.

From code-compliant footings to gutter systems that handle spring runoff, every detail accounts for Des Moines climate challenges.

How long does a 3 season room addition take?

Most 3 season room projects in Des Moines take 6–10 weeks from groundbreaking to final inspection, depending on size and weather.

Do I need a building permit for a room addition?

Yes. Any room addition in Des Moines requires a permit. We handle the paperwork and coordinate all inspections for you.

What's the difference between a 3 season and 4 season room?

A 3 season room uses screening for spring, summer, and fall use. A 4 season room has insulated walls, heating, and glass for year-round comfort.

Can you match my home's roof style and siding?

Yes. We custom-design every addition to match your home's architecture, roof pitch, and exterior materials for a seamless look.

How does the foundation handle Des Moines freeze-thaw cycles?

We pour footings below frost line and use proper drainage and vapor barriers to protect against Iowa's moisture and temperature swings.
